import os
import torch
import torch.distributed as dist
import time
def main():
dist.init_process_group("nccl")
local_rank = int(os.environ["LOCAL_RANK"])
torch.cuda.set_device(local_rank)
rank = dist.get_rank()
world_size = dist.get_world_size()
print(f"[rank {rank}/{world_size}] started")
model = torch.nn.Linear(16, 16).cuda()
for step in range(50):
x = torch.randn(32, 16).cuda()
loss = model(x).sum()
loss.backward()
if rank == 0 and step % 10 == 0:
print(f"step={step}, loss={loss.item()}")
time.sleep(0.2)
dist.barrier()
dist.destroy_process_group()
if __name__ == "__main__":
main()
